Move 方法 功能:将一个指定的文件或文件夹从一个地方移动到另一个地方。 语法:Move destination destination 必需的。文件或文件夹要移动到的目标。不允许有通配符。 说明: Move 方法对一个 File 或 Folder 的结果和执行 FileSystemObject.MoveFile 或 FileSystemObject.MoveFolder 操作的结果是一样的。但应当注意,后面的方法能够移动多个文件或文件夹。 示例:
代码第二次运行时会产生路径未找到错误,这个需要注意。
建议在操作前可以先检测下路径是否存在,避免错误。
如果在移动前已经有与目标文件夹名相同的,则会产生下图错误:
如果把fd.Move"d:\test3”改为fd.Move"d:\test3\",则test2文件夹会移动到test3文件夹中成为test3的一个子文件夹。 上面两个示例代码在结束前忘了添加set nothing释放对象变量了,各位还是要养成好习惯。
|